CAPE: Good Intentions, Mediocre Results

CAPE: Good Intentions, Mediocre Results

CAPE is based on the work of Professor Robert Shiller of Yale, adapted by DoubleLine, the ETF's parent company. The fund has a good idea and design, but the execution has not been there. The process has not produced notable results in up or down markets. I rate CAPE a sell.
